The Road King is a
touring bike that features the classic looks of a big boulevard cruiser. At the
heart of the Road King is the Twin Cam 88 engine, isolation mounted in a
touring frame for comfortable riding. It features an easy shifting
transmission, a large electronic speedometer mounted in a die cast chrome dash,
along with a massive, nostalgic chrome headlamp and nacelle to accent the
traditional styling of the Road King model. This particular example is a 1

105-Year-Old Woman Rides A Harley-Davidson
Wed, 29 May 2013When you get to be 105 years old, clearly your best years are behind you. However, that didn’t stop Ella Passmore of Richmond Hill, Georgia from trying something new and daring for the first time. To celebrate over a century of living, Passmore rode on a Harley-Davidson, as reported by www.savannahnow.com.
Aerosmith and Toby Keith to Join Kid Rock as Headliners of Harley-Davidson’s 110th Anniversary Celebrations
Thu, 11 Apr 2013Rock and Roll Hall of Famers Aerosmith and country artist Toby Keith were introduced as headline performers along with the previously announced Kid Rock for Harley-Davidson‘s 110th anniversary celebration. Each headline concert will be held at the Marcus Amphitheater at the south side of Henry Maier Festival Park (A.K.A. the Summerfest Grounds) in Harley-Davidson‘s hometown Milwaukee.
